What size tires
Well i will be getting my new tires soon so i want to know what size i should get! I have a 3 inch lift kit on my jeep. I want to find the best tires that would be round 32 to 33 and stick out side of jeep just a tad. But the best wheels for the best gas. I was looking at 305/70/16 but i think there to wide and kill my gas. So plz help and put pictures up if you can thanks!
#2
From my reading all the info on here, I would stick with a set of 30's or 31's....unless you shaved off some fender as well as took off the fender flares. Good chance you may not see a horrible drop in mpg's. I would guess less than 2 mpg, if that

If you want a lifted JEEP with big tires, FORGET about good gas mileage. Bigger tires will hurt the MPG, diameter and width. AXEL gearing will need to be changed to restore SOME of the lost MPG and power.
